If it were me (and I hope it will be, soon, if we can entirely shut down svn internally), I would prefer to use git-filter-branch to go through *all* my checkins and fix up the CRLFs in all of them. That way the history will be clean and diffs/annotates/merges will go more smoothly. Does anyone know the most efficient way to do this with git-filter-branch, when there are already thousands of files in the repo with CRLF in them? Running dos2unix on all the files for every single revision could take a *very* long time. Have fun, Avery
